Asbestos Class Action Litigation

Asbestos suits can provide compensation for victims and their families. Anyone who was exposed to asbestos and later developed mesothelioma, lung cancer, or other asbestos-related illness can file an individual or class action lawsuit.

The litigation process includes providing medical bills, employment and other records to your attorney. You may be required to attend depositions.

Why Asbestos Illnesses?

Asbestos is a hazard cancer-causing material that was once used extensively in commercial and building projects. Asbestos-containing products are destroyed, releasing tiny fibers into the air. These can be inhaled. These fibers can lead to life-threatening and fatal diseases such as mesothelioma and asbestosis.

Mesothelioma is a fatal form of lung cancer that is caused by exposure to asbestos fibers. The disease can take decades to develop. Mesothelioma symptoms can include breathing difficulties, asbestos class Action litigation frequent coughing, and chest pain.

An experienced lawyer can help victims and their families in recovering compensation from asbestos companies to cover future and past medical expenses as well as lost wages and other damages. Additionally, a mesothelioma lawsuit can award punitive damages in order to punish defendants for their reckless behavior.

Although every asbestos claim is unique, the underlying elements are the same. Each victim must show that they were exposed, that they have been diagnosed with a disease related to asbestos exposure and that they are entitled to compensation.

What is asbestos litigation wiki Litigation?

When you have been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ness and you want to file a lawsuit, it is a good method to hold the manufacturer accountable for their negligence. A successful mesothelioma claim requires evidence that you were exposed to asbestos litigation wiki and that exposure was the cause of your condition. To prove your claim your lawyer may have to review medical records, collect employment records, or talk with unions, coworkers or other workers.

Asbestos litigation is the longest-running mass tort in U.S. history, spanning decades. Hundreds of people have declared bankruptcy and set up trust funds to compensate victims. Scientists have proven for a long time that asbestos can cause lung damage and causes diseases.

Mesothelioma suits se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. In the past mesothelioma lawsuits had been filed as class actions. It was believed that a single lawsuit would be fair to victims. However it is now acknowledged that individual mesothelioma claims are more likely to result in substantial settlements for victims. Asbestos lawsuits may be personal injury or wrongful death claims. Every case is unique. It is crucial to partner with a mesothelioma attorney firm with a nationwide network of lawyers. When should I file a Lawsuit?

It is important that victims and their families take action as fast as they can, even though it may take some time to file a lawsuit. The statutes of limitations differ by state, but most asbestos victims have between one and five years from the time of diagnosis or discovery to make a claim.

Mesothelioma may develop from 10 to 40 years after exposure. many patients who suffer from mesothelioma were exposed to different asbestos products at various times in their lives. A lawsuit can bring asbestos manufacturers to account for their negligence and compensate victims.

A class action settlement provides a means for multiple mesothelioma plaintiffs to pursue compensation from the same company. The U.S. Supreme Court ruled, however, that companies should not settle with the class members prior Asbestos Class Action Litigation to a diagnosis with asbestos-related illnesses.

Asbestos lawsuits are currently primarily filed as individual mesothelioma lawsuits. These lawsuits are similar in nature to class action claims, but have individual defendants. They also take an approach to litigation that is more specific. Individual cases allow victims to be awarded higher damages. The jury will consider the specific asbestos-related diseases and exposure histories of each victim. What is the difference between trials and settlements?

Although each asbestos lawsuit is unique, the majority follow a similar process. The plaintiff, or the person who files the lawsuit, must prove that they were exposed and suffered from an asbestos-related illness. They must also show that the company responsible for the exposure caused the exposure. This is accomplished through many different methods such as documents regarding employment and medical records, expert witnesses, and many more.

In the past asbestos victims have filed many cases as class actions. Class action lawsuits are a way for one person to sue on behalf of a group that has been similarly affected. The class is represented by a team of attorneys who define the members of the class and then submit the lawsuit to the court for its approval.

However the law has changed and class actions are no longer a great way to help people access justice in mesothelioma-related cases. Mesothelioma lawyers and judges have noticed that a single lawsuit often does not sufficiently resemble the other cases in the class being proposed and is more effective for the victims to file individual claims for personal injury or wrongful death.

Some individuals may also be able file claims with bankruptcy trusts that have been established from the bankrupt asbestos companies. Trust fund claims require less evidence than a typical lawsuit, and provide victims with a faster route to compensation.
